Pular para o conteúdo principal

Atualizar receita

POST /update_income

Resumo

Rota para atualizar receitas.

Descrição

Permite atualização parcial ou completa dos dados de uma receita.


Requisição

Headers

  • Content-Type: application/json

Body da Requisição

ParâmetroTipoDescriçãoExemploPadrão
access_tokenstringToken de acesso da API.aaaaaaaa-bbbb-cccc-dddd-eeeeeeeeeeee-
unit_tokenstringToken da unidade.aaaaaaaa-bbbb-cccc-dddd-eeeeeeeeeeee-
id_token_incomestringToken da receita.aaaaaaaa-bbbb-cccc-dddd-eeeeeeeeeeee-
due_datestringData de vencimento em YYYY-MM-DD.2025-03-20-
datestringAlias de due_date.2025-03-20-
pay_daystringData de pagamento em YYYY-MM-DD.2025-03-15-
competence_datestringData de competência em YYYY-MM-DD.2025-03-01due_date ou date ao alterar datas
competencestringAlias de competence_date.2025-03-01-
category_id_tokenstringCategoria de receita.aaaaaaaa-bbbb-cccc-dddd-eeeeeeeeeeee-
prev_valuenumberValor base.30.5-
descriptionstringDescrição.Descrição da receita-
id_token_actionnumberStatus da receita.1-
id_token_bank_accountstringConta bancária.aaaaaaaa-bbbb-cccc-dddd-eeeeeeeeeeee-
id_token_projectstringProjeto.aaaaaaaa-bbbb-cccc-dddd-eeeeeeeeeeee-
id_token_contactstringContato.aaaaaaaa-bbbb-cccc-dddd-eeeeeeeeeeee-
id_token_unitstringUnidade.aaaaaaaa-bbbb-cccc-dddd-eeeeeeeeeeee-
id_token_bank_account_outstringConta bancária de saída.aaaaaaaa-bbbb-cccc-dddd-eeeeeeeeeeee-
discountsnumberDescontos.10-
interestnumberJuros.4-
data_bankstringDados bancários complementares.Banco XPTO-

Exemplo de requisição

curl -s -X POST 'https://portal.fipli.pro/api/v1/update_income' \
-d '{
"access_token":"<access_token>",
"unit_token":"<unit_token>",
"id_token_income":"<id_token_income>",
"date":"<date>",
"pay_day":"<pay_day>",
"competence":"<competence>",
"category_id_token":"<category_id_token>"
}' \
-H 'Content-Type: application/json'

Respostas

200 Sucesso

{
"success": true,
"message": "Income updated successfuly",
"data": null
}

Observações

  • date pode ser usado no lugar de due_date
  • competence pode ser usado no lugar de competence_date
  • Se competence_date não for informado ao atualizar datas, a API usa due_date ou date